			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-13632" title="rahul gandhi"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/rahul-gandhi-300x199.jpg" alt="rahul gandhi" width="300" height="199" />Kanpur : Youth only upto the age of 35 years will get a chance to meet AICC general secretary Rahul Gandhi during his one-day visit to this industrial town, in a move aimed to build the party base among the younger generation.</p>
<p>Rahul will meet industrial workers, rickshaw pullers and labourers upto an age of 35 years on December 8, city Congress President Mahesh Diskhit said, adding anyone more than 35 years of age will not be allowed to meet him.</p>
<p>During his meeting with the workers, Rahul will listen to their problems and try to come out with solutions, MP from Kanpur and Union Coal Minister Sri Prakash Jaiswal told PTI.</p>
<p>The MP from Amethi constituency will also muster support of youth in party&#8217;s membership drive.</p>
<p>The Indian Youth Congress has launched a membership drive, ending December 15, in 26 Lok Sabha constituencies of the state to draw youths towards the party.</p>
<p>&#8220;Rahul is expected to visit a number of constituencies where the membership drive is going on. He also plans to meet youth party leaders during his one-day trip,&#8221; Jaiswal said.</p>
<p>During his visit, Rahul will meet probable candidates for 2012 Assembly polls, he said.</p>
<p>Later in the day, the Congress leader will also attend programmes to be organised in Kannuaj, Farrukhabad and Etawah and Kanpur (rural).</p>
<p>Rahul will also meet city&#8217;s young businessmen where he will discuss their problems, he said.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-13409"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/chelsea-219x300.jpg" alt="" width="219" height="300" />London: Darron Gibson fired holders Manchester United through to the last four of the English League Cup on Tuesday with a 2-0 win at Old Trafford that ended Tottenham Hotspur&#8217;s hopes of a third successive final.</p>
<p>United, who beat Spurs on penalties in last season&#8217;s Wembley final, were joined in the semi-finals by Aston Villa after the five-times winners beat Premier League stragglers Portsmouth 4-2 at Fratton Park.</p>
<p>Big-spending Manchester City host Arsenal while league leaders Chelsea travel to Blackburn Rovers for Wednesday&#8217;s quarter-finals.</p>
<p>With the rain sweeping down, young Irish midfielder Gibson opened the scoring for United against the run of play in the 16th minute and doubled his tally 22 minutes later with a powerful shot to the top corner from 18 metres.</p>
<p>The scoreline flattered United&#8217;s youthful-looking team, however, with Tottenham playing the better football for much of the first half as they sought their first win at Old Trafford in 20 years.</p>
<p>Jermain Defoe tested United goalkeeper Tomasz Kuszczak in the seventh minute and had a great chance in the 21st when he found space at the back post only to be denied by the rock-steady Nemanja Vidic in defence.</p>
<p>Villa made a woeful start at Portsmouth, going behind in the 10th minute when Stilian Petrov tried to clear at the near post but sliced the ball into his own net.</p>
<p>Portsmouth, who lost 4-1 to United at the weekend, had little time to enjoy their lead with Emile Heskey equalising two minutes later.</p>
<p>Villa made it 2-1 in the 27th through James Milner and went 3-1 ahead in the 74th when England winger Stewart Downing headed in at the far post to score on his first start for the club.</p>
<p>Kanu pulled a goal back with a low shot in the 87th but Ashley Young restored Villa&#8217;s lead two minutes later with a deflected shot high into the net.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-13283"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/capta-206x300.jpg" alt="" width="206" height="300" />PARIS: Roger Federer has topped the ATP end-of-year world rankings for the fifth time during his career having ceded the position last year to<br />
Roger Rafael Nadal.</p>
<p>The 28-year-old Swiss star, who won the French Open and Wimbledon during the summer, was world No.1 previously from 2004 to 2007 and he is now level with Jimmy Connors and one behind the all-time best set by Pete Sampras from 1993 to 1998.</p>
<p>Federer has also topped the rankings for 259 weeks and is closing in on the record of 286 weeks held by Sampras.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-13183"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/prostate-205x300.jpg" alt="" width="205" height="300" />London: Obesity can increase risk among people with HIV, according to a new study.</p>
<p>The study has shown that antiretroviral therapy may not be as effective on obese HIV patients as it is with people of normal weight.</p>
<p>Researchers from the Uniformed Services University of the Health Sciences, who conducted the study, insisted that the immune systems among obese people with HIV do not respond as well as it does among normal weight people with HIV.</p>
<p>Nancy Crum-Cianflone, MD, who presented the study at the annual meeting of the Infectious Diseases Society of America, said: “Obese patients were found to regain fewer CD4-positive T cells after they start therapy than do people with normal weight,” said Dr. Crum-Cianflone.</p>
<p>“These findings don’t align with some of the earlier studies done prior to the advent of modern highly active antiretroviral therapy (HAART), when patients who were obese did better than those of normal or below-normal weight.”</p>
<p>Data collected by the USU’s Infectious Disease Clinical Research Program (IDCRP) from participants in the US Military Natural History Study, was assessed as part of the study.</p>
<p>The data had details of 1,119 people, including documented dates of HIV seroconversion between 1986 and 2008.</p>
<p>Captain (Dr) Greg Martin, director of the IDCRP said: “The irony is that in the past we have been concerned that patients with HIV infection were losing too much weight.</p>
<p>“Yet this research is showing that there needs to be more of a focus on maintaining a balanced weight without going to the other extreme.”</p>
<p>Earlier studies had hinted that when HAART was unavailable, patients who were obese lost CD4 cells more slowly than people who had normal or below-normal weight.</p>
<p>Crum-Cianflone mentioned that the introduction of HAART has resulted in immune system recovery, which is measured by an increase in the number of CD4 cells.</p>
<p>She concluded that the study also &#8220;suggests that low CD4 counts may be another adverse consequence of obesity.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-12627" title="RahulBhatt"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/RahulBhatt-300x199.jpg" alt="RahulBhatt" width="300" height="199" />Mumbai : There are now reports that David Headley used filmmaker Mahesh Bhatt&#8217;s son Rahul Bhatt as a cover for his reconnaissance of 26/11 targets like the Taj, the Trident and Leopold Cafe.</p>
<p>Sources say Headley insisted on taking an unsuspecting Rahul to these places. The visits to these targets took place between November 2006 and March 2008.</p>
<p>Sources in the National Investigation Agency (NIA) say that Rahul had neither any inkling of Headley&#8217;s designs nor could he understand the code language the Lashkar frontman used while talking on the phone.</p>
<p>Rahul is believed to have told the investigators that he found Headley&#8217;s behaviour odd at times and it is only now that he has realised that what Headley spoke on the phone was some code language.</p>
<p>Home Ministry sources have already said that investigators do not consider Rahul a suspect, but efforts are on to ascertain if he had unwittingly helped American terror suspect David Headley.</p>
<p>Moreover, in a statement that could come as some relief to Rahul Bhatt, Joint Commissioner of Mumbai Police, Rakesh Maria told NDTV that Rahul was only being looked upon as a witness at the moment.</p>
<p>Maria also made a point of the fact that Rahul had come up to the police to tell them that he knew Headley. Maria said: &#8220;Rahul Bhatt came to us with information voluntarily that the Rahul being referred to in the emails is him. So, it is wrong to prejudge his guilt. Rahul is a witness at the moment.&#8221;</p>
<p>Earlier, Rahul, who was befriended by Lashkar operative David Headley in a gym, was told not to leave Mumbai till investigation in the case is over. Two of his friends have also been asked not to leave the city.</p>
<p>Rahul Bhatt was a trainer in a posh Mumbai gym where Headley was a member. The Bhatt family has claimed that it was Rahul who approached investigators after realising who Headley was.</p>
<p>Headley, a key suspect in a terror plot against India and Denmark uncovered by the FBI, was arrested in Chicago last month.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-12534"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/was-300x300.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="300" />London: Hundreds of Al Qaeda terrorists remain in the Federally Administered Tribal Areas (FATA) of Pakistan, continuing to receive explosives and weapons training in camps in that country, British Prime Minister Gordon Brown has said.</p>
<p>&#8220;There are still several hundred foreign fighters based in the FATA area of Pakistan and travelling to training camps to learn bomb making and weapons skills,&#8221; Brown said Monday night in a speech defending Britain&#8217;s continuing military presence in Afghanistan.</p>
<p>&#8220;It is because of the nature of the threat, and because around three quarters of the most serious plots the security services are now tracking in Britain have links to Pakistan, that it does not make sense to confine our defence against terrorism solely to actions inside the UK,&#8221; Brown said.</p>
<p>Brown&#8217;s comments come amid a rising demand for Britain to withdraw its 9,000 troops from Afghanistan, fuelled by a death toll of 232 since 2001.</p>
<p>But Brown said that since January 2008 seven of the top dozen Al Qaeda figures have been killed &#8220;depleting its reserve of experienced leaders and sapping its morale&#8221;.</p>
<p>He said the multi-nation force in Afghanistan had had &#8220;greater success in this one year to disable Al Qaeda&#8221; than in any year since the invasion of Afghanistan following the 9/11 attacks in 2001.</p>
<p>&#8220;Al Qaeda rely on a permissive environment in the tribal areas of Pakistan and &#8211; if they can re-establish one &#8211; in Afghanistan,&#8221; he said.</p>
<p>&#8220;We are there because action in Afghanistan is not an alternative to action in Pakistan, but an inseparable support to it.&#8221;</p>
<p>Brown also offered London as the venue for an international conference on Afghanistan early next year, where he is expected to discuss a timetable for withdrawal of forces.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-12445" title="tendulkar" src="http://www.currentnewsindia.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/tendulkar-256x300.jpg" alt="tendulkar" width="256" height="300" />MUMBAI/DELHI: Ageing Shiv Sena patriarch Bal Thackeray on Monday alienated himself from millions of Indians when he attacked the country&#8217;s icon<br />
Maharashtra&#8217;s most loved son, Sachin Tendulkar, for saying that &#8220;Mumbai belonged to all Indians&#8221;. In an editorial in the Sena mouthpiece, Saamna, Thackeray, warned Sachin to &#8220;keep off the political pitch&#8221; for his own well-being. Or else, he would have &#8220;run out&#8221; from Marathi minds.</p>
<p>While 82-year-old Thackeray&#8217;s attack appears to have been motivated by competitive politics with his nephew, Raj, to appear as a bigger champion of Marathi interests, it appears to have backfired. Parties cutting across political lines and Marathi intellectuals and civil society leaders expressed their disgust at Thackeray&#8217;s editorial which, they said, was &#8220;worthy of the dustbin&#8221;.</p>
<p>In that sense, the attack on Sachin Tendulkar &#8212; as Maharashtra chief minister Ashok Chavan said &#8212; has united India. Thackeray&#8217;s editorial addressed the legendary cricketer to say: &#8220;What was the need to say this? Your remark has cut through every Marathi heart&#8230; Mumbai may be India&#8217;s commercial capital. But don&#8217;t ever forget that it is Maharashtra&#8217;s capital.&#8221;</p>
<p>The Sena supremo advised Sachin not to stray into politics: &#8220;Keep this in mind &#8212; people praise you when you hit a six or a four. However, don&#8217;t use your tongue to bat against the just and legitimate rights of the Marathi `manoos&#8217;. They will not like it.&#8221; Thackeray signed off the letter with an &#8220;affectionate warning&#8221;: &#8220;Don&#8217;t lose on the pitch of politics whatever you have earned on the cricketing pitch&#8221;.</p>
<p>Thackeray also reminded Tendulkar of the Samyukta Maharashtra agitation for the inclusion of Mumbai in the linguistic Marathi state. The stir in the 1950s claimed 105 lives of Marathis who fell to the bullets of the then Morarji Desai state government.</p>
<p>Alarmed by the Sena leader&#8217;s warning, BCCI vice president Rajiv Shukla said Thackeray should be brought to book while a furious Lalu Prasad said, &#8220;Sachin is a national hero. Who is Bal Thackeray to comment on him?&#8221; Congress spokesman Manish Tiwari said, &#8220;The real place for Bal Thackeray&#8217;s statement is the dustbin.&#8221;</p>
